On July 09 2010 02:48 TimeToPractice! wrote:
Show nested quote +
On July 09 2010 02:40 Bibdy wrote:
I remember reading about a month ago on here, someone mentioned that Browder said (who's friend's cousin's former roommate who once went on a date with Kevin Bacon, said...) they were looking into PvP and the problem that you needed to match your opponent's number of gateways early in the game, or you had a massive chance of losing.

I think the Zealot nerf is a result of that, and the Reaper/Barracks build time change a result of that...did they forget about Zerg or something?


You'd think if it were just that... they wouldn't of nerfed the cooldown period for a zealot warping in though - because you dont have to match zealots anymore after that early game.


Its in the period prior to Warp-Gate tech. If someone 2-Gates you, you have to build another Gateway yourself, quickly, make a choke out of the buildings and either try to match the Zealot count, get a Cannon (hah), or bee-line for Stalkers/Sentries.

The Zealot build time nerf would make it easier to get Stalkers/Sentries out before there's a critical mass number of Zealots smashing down your front door.

#395
Baneling model changed: now have more of your color (if you're blue it's more blue).
^ I think this is awesome! It looks great on my... custom low/medium setting

Ultras get +2 and +2 vs armored per upgrade, instead of +3 per upgrade.

Hum... that would really leave anti-small units for zerglings and baneling.
There is now a 1 second cooldown for Transfusion from the Queen. With the Creep Tumor cooldown=doubled change, I'm starting to think I shouldn't have sent Day9 those reps lolol

Oh sht! I don't mind the transfusion coolddown, but omg will IdrA rage when he discovers that he can't creep out as fast! :O double the cooldown is a major nerf for those who wants to creep really fast, though it won't change that much the overall balance. Guess we just have to get used to it :/
Neural Parasite lasts about 12-ish in-game seconds.

I.. don't mind the 12 seconds duration because my infestors die anyway b4 that, but at least make it 75 energy or something, because now it just tells me that fungal growth >>> NP instead of FG > NP
Roaches can no longer move under Force Fields while burrowed!!!!
burrowing roach shenanigans with FF

Hum.. interesting, no more retreating for zerg, and no more sneaking through a FF... I think that'll mean more Ultra play IMO. And with the always frenzied ultras now, it's really powerful
Infested Terrans lasts 30 seconds (up from 20).
Infested Terran spell can now be cast while Infestor is Burrowed.

ohhh finally, this change is really something for small drops! without raven or scan, you can sneak into a tank line and spew infested terran all over.. wait have to check woot!

Overall good patch for zerg
